Course Content

• Introduction to Gas Giant Systems: Formation and Evolution
• Atmospheric Dynamics of Gas Giants: Winds, Storms, and Cloud Structures
• Planetary Rings and Moons: Composition, Formation, and Dynamics
• Gas Giant Magnetospheres: Magnetic Fields and Auroras
• Exploring Gas Giants: Spacecraft Missions and Data Analysis (Includes keywords: *Jupiter*, *Saturn*, *Uranus*, *Neptune*)
• Comparative Planetology: Gas Giants vs. Ice Giants
• The Search for Exoplanets: Gas Giants Beyond Our Solar System
• Gas Giant Atmospheres: Composition and Chemical Processes
• Data Analysis Techniques for Gas Giant Observations

Career path

Career Role in Gas Giant Systems (UK) Description
Planetary Scientist (Gas Giants Focus) Research and analyze atmospheric dynamics, composition, and evolution of gas giants. High demand for expertise in advanced modeling techniques.
Exoplanet Researcher (Gas Giant Specialization) Discover and characterize exoplanets, specializing in the study of gas giants beyond our solar system. Requires strong data analysis and astronomical observation skills.
Astrophysicist (Gas Giant Dynamics) Investigate the physical processes within gas giants, including internal structure, magnetic fields, and atmospheric phenomena. Strong theoretical physics background needed.
Spacecraft Engineer (Gas Giant Missions) Design, develop, and test spacecraft systems for missions to gas giants. Requires expertise in propulsion, navigation, and communication systems.
